What is a citation?

A

Citations are mentions of your businesses NAP info on other websites. Third party backups of your business info that help prove to Google’s algorithm that you’re a local business at your location.

What are 2 kinds of citations?

A

Directory listings - Nap info listed in a structured format

Unstructured citations - Nap info listed in long form content like press releases or blog content.

Why are citations important?

A

They’re more important for showing up in the Map pack. If you don’t have your citations set up correctly then it becomes difficult to show up in map pack results.

How can you check which citations matter?

A

Do a quick Google search and look at the listings that come up. Make sure that any site listing your NAP info is displaying the correct information.
